Xigris (Zy-gris, drotrecogin alfa), the first drug APPROVED for treating severe sepsis

Lilly is now marketing Xigris (Zy-gris, drotrecogin alfa), the first drug APPROVED for treating severe sepsis.

Until now, the main treatment for severe sepsis was antibiotics.

Xigris is the first drug shown to improve survival in cases of severe septic infections.
